Yie Liu is a scholar working on Molecular Biology, Physiology and Oncology. According to data from OpenAlex, Yie Liu has authored 62 papers receiving a total of 2.4k indexed citations (citations by other indexed papers that have themselves been cited), including 49 papers in Molecular Biology, 38 papers in Physiology and 12 papers in Oncology. Recurrent topics in Yie Liu’s work include Telomeres, Telomerase, and Senescence (38 papers), DNA Repair Mechanisms (27 papers) and CRISPR and Genetic Engineering (8 papers). Yie Liu is often cited by papers focused on Telomeres, Telomerase, and Senescence (38 papers), DNA Repair Mechanisms (27 papers) and CRISPR and Genetic Engineering (8 papers). Yie Liu collaborates with scholars based in United States, Sweden and Canada. Yie Liu's co-authors include Jian Lü, Lea Harrington, Yisong Wang, David B. Rhee, Vilhelm A. Bohr, Haritha Vallabhaneni, Natalie Erdmann, Stefan Einhorn, Dan Grandér and John R. Dunlap and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Nucleic Acids Research and Journal of Biological Chemistry.
